SOUTHWEST FISHING REPORT

Alumni Pond: Closed for repairs until further notice.

Bear Canyon Lake: Fishing for catfish was fair to good when using PowerBait.

Bill Evans Lake: Fishing for trout and catfish was good when using PowerBait Mice Tails and Green PowerBait.

Elephant Butte Lake: Fishing for white bass was fair to good when using chrome Kastmasters.

Escondida Lake: Fishing for catfish was good when using PowerBait.

Gila River: Streamflow near Gila Wednesday morning was 41.2 cfs. Fishing for trout was fair to good when using dry flies and nymphs.

Gila Waters: Streamflow near Gila Hot Springs Wednesday morning was 42 cfs. Fishing for Gila trout in Whitewater Creek was slow to fair when using flies.

Lake Roberts: Fishing for trout was good when trolling Rooster Tails.

Quemado Lake: Fishing for trout was slow to fair when using Garlic PowerBait.

Rancho Grande Ponds: Fishing for rainbow trout was good when using PowerBait.

Rio Grande: Streamflow below Elephant Butte Dam on Wednesday morning was 25.4 cfs.

Young Pond: Fishing for bluegill was good when using Neon Green Glitter PowerBait.
